Hanwha Aerospace will hold investor relations (IR) meetings for major overseas institutional investors in Singapore and Hong Kong from May 19 to May 23, 2025, to explain its Q1 2025 business performance.
📊 [Key Disclosure Contents & Major Figures Summary]
- Target Company: Hanwha Aerospace (012450)
- Date & Period: May 19, 2025 – May 23, 2025
- Location: Singapore, Hong Kong
- Target Audience: Major overseas institutional investors
- Purpose: Enhance investor understanding through Q1 2025 business performance presentation
- Format: 1-on-1 meetings and group meetings
- Sponsoring Institution: Korea Investment & Securities Co., Ltd.
- Key Topics: Q1 2025 business results, outlook, and Q&A
- Board/Decision Date: May 09, 2025
- IR Material Publication Date: April 30, 2025
- Related Website: https://www.hanwhaaerospace.com
- Other Remarks: Detailed schedule is subject to change depending on company circumstances
